Syrian Church has lost its ‘abundance of vocations’ due to civil war

The Maronite Archeparch of Damascus, Samir Nassar, laments that family and vocations, two pillars that support the life of Syria’s Christians, are now lost, as the Church in war-torn Syria has gone from “an abundance of vocations” to only 37 seminarians in formation.
